  • Patent number: 5664307
    Abstract: A draw process is described, in which yarns in particular of thermoplastic plastics are drawn by influencing their temperature, so as to improve the yarn properties. The process can be employed in a spin process or in a subsequent improvement step. In accordance with the invention, the temperature of the temperature modulating device is controlled as a function of a yarn tension signal, which is obtained within or downstream of the draw zone.

  • Patent number: 5577676
    Abstract: A method and apparatus for controlling the traversing frequency during the winding of a cross-wound package. In so doing, a signal is detected which is generated by the motion of the yarn while being wound onto a yarn package. Thereafter, the signal is analyzed by frequency, and/or amplitude, or other characteristics. Finally, the traversing frequency of the yarn takeup system is adjusted or varied as a function of the analysis result. In the preferred embodiment, the signal is proportional to a development of airborne sound or a development of solid-borne sound, each of which is generated in response to the motion of the advancing yarn on the package being formed. The method of the present invention allows disturbances in the winding operation to be avoided, such as the formation of so-called ribbons and similar phenomena.

  • Patent number: 5354529
    Abstract: A melt spinning apparatus adapted for spinning a plurality of preferably monofilaments each having a denier which is maintained within close tolerances. The apparatus comprises a nozzle head having a plurality of vertical bores which are annularly arranged about a central axis and a nozzle assembly in each of the bores. A separate melt delivery system delivers pressurized melt to each nozzle assembly, and in a preferred embodiment, each separate melt delivery system comprises one of the discharge outlets of a planetary gear pump.

  • Patent number: 5088168
    Abstract: A yarn texturing apparatus is disclosed which includes a nozzle having a yarn duct therethrough, and a perforated stuffer box at the outlet end of the duct. Heated air is introduced into the duct, and the air is heated by a heater which is positioned in the air supply line leading to the nozzle. The output of the heater is controlled by a temperature sensor which is positioned inside the stuffer box. Also, the nozzle comprises two confronting sections which can be separated to facilitate yarn thread-up, and a valve is provided in the supply line to divert the heated air to an exhaust line when the nozzle is opened. A second temperature sensor is positioned in the supply line and is operative when the nozzle is opened to regulate the output of the heater and avoid large fluctuations of its output.

  • Patent number: 4301578
    Abstract: In the stuffing of synthetic continuous filamentary threads in stuffer boxes, special value is to be placed on the thermal treatment and especially the cooling of the initially crimped filaments. The filaments in the configuration of a compact thread plug, which is formed in the stuffer box, can be wound on a rotatably driven drum in several helical windings, the last thread plug winding can then be disentangled again at the end of the drum, and the finished texturized thread drawn off. The disentangling of the thread plug and the drawing off of the thread is improved by the present invention through an application of axial and/or radial forces or pressures onto the last thread plug winding in the region of the disentangling point. Suitable mechanical and pneumatic devices are provided by the invention for this purpose.
